ABOUT THE MAZDA MAZDA6

The Mazda6 is a mid-size sedan aimed at drivers who want a more engaging, driver-focused alternative to the mainstream family sedan crowd. Offered in the 2019 through 2021 model years covered here, it targets buyers who appreciate refined styling and a premium feel without fully crossing into luxury-brand territory. It competes in one of the most scrutinized segments in the American market.

VERDICT

The 2019 Mazda Mazda6 earns an NHTSA Safety Index of 87 out of 100, a strong result driven by its federal crash-test stars and its recall record. Both frontal and side crash protection reached the full 5 stars. It has 1 recall on record, reflected in the score.

WHAT REVIEWERS SAY

Reviewers generally regard the Mazda6 as one of the most rewarding mid-size sedans to drive, praising its responsive handling, upscale interior quality, and composed ride. They tend to highlight it as a strong choice for buyers who prioritize driving engagement and refinement, though some note that its cargo and technology offerings can trail segment leaders.

NHTSA // RECALLSRecall record

ENGINE19V497000

Risk: An unexpected stall increases the risk of a crash.

Remedy: Mazda will notify owners, and dealers will reprogram the PCM software, free of charge. The recall began August 20, 2019. Owners may contact Mazda customer service at 1-800-222-5500, option 4. Mazda's number for this recall is 3719F.

Reported 2019-06-27
